Bold, spicy, tangy, and satisfyingly savory—the Korean BBQ Meatball Banh Mi is a sandwich that takes no shortcuts on flavor. Picture this: juicy, tender meatballs glazed in sticky Korean BBQ sauce, nestled in a crusty baguette alongside crisp pickled veggies, fresh herbs, and a creamy slather of mayo. It’s a beautiful mashup of East meets West, combining the deep umami of Korean cuisine with the classic crunch and contrast of a Vietnamese banh mi.
This fusion sandwich is perfect for weeknight dinners, casual gatherings, or even meal-prep lunches. The contrast of textures—soft meatballs, crunchy vegetables, chewy bread—paired with the explosive flavor profile makes each bite better than the last. Whether you’re a fan of Korean flavors, banh mi sandwiches, or simply crave something new and delicious, this recipe is bound to earn a spot in your regular rotation.
Why You’ll Love This Korean BBQ Meatball Banh Mi
- Big Flavors, Simple Prep: You get the complexity of Korean BBQ and the balance of banh mi without the hours-long process.
- Customizable: Swap proteins, adjust spice levels, or add your favorite pickles.
- Make-Ahead Friendly: Meatballs and pickled veggies can be prepped in advance.
- Street Food Vibes at Home: It feels gourmet but is totally weeknight doable.
Preparation Phase & Tools to Use
Essential Tools and Equipment:
- Mixing Bowls: For combining meatball ingredients and tossing your quick-pickled vegetables.
- Baking Sheet or Skillet: Choose based on how you like your meatballs—baked for easy cleanup, or pan-fried for extra browning.
- Microplane or Grater: Crucial for finely grating garlic and ginger into your meatball mix.
- Mandoline or Sharp Knife: To get those veggies nice and thin for the banh mi crunch.
- Small Saucepan: Needed to warm your Korean BBQ glaze for optimal cling on the meatballs.
- Toaster Oven or Oven: For getting your baguette perfectly crisp on the outside, soft on the inside.
These tools don’t just make life easier—they guarantee the textures and flavors you want in a high-quality banh mi. A crunchy baguette, caramelized meatballs, and tangy veggies all depend on using the right gear.


Ingredients for the Korean BBQ Meatball Banh Mi
Ground Pork or Ground Beef – The base of the meatballs, juicy and tender with a good fat content for flavor.
Garlic and Ginger – These aromatic powerhouses bring boldness and authenticity to the Korean-style meatballs.
Soy Sauce and Sesame Oil – Add depth and that signature umami punch.
Panko Breadcrumbs and Egg – Help bind the meatballs while keeping them light and juicy.
Korean BBQ Sauce (Gochujang-based or store-bought) – Sticky, sweet, spicy—this glaze turns meatballs into flavor bombs.
Baguette – The backbone of banh mi; crunchy on the outside, soft and chewy inside.
Pickled Carrots and Daikon – Add tang and crunch to balance the richness of the meatballs.
Fresh Cilantro – Bright and herbal, a classic banh mi essential.
Jalapeños (optional) – For those who love a kick of heat.
Mayonnaise – Creamy and cool, it mellows the bold flavors and adds richness.
How To Make the Korean BBQ Meatball Banh Mi
Step 1: Make the Meatball Mixture
In a mixing bowl, combine ground pork (or beef), minced garlic, grated ginger, soy sauce, sesame oil, panko breadcrumbs, and egg. Mix until just combined—don’t overwork it!
Step 2: Shape and Cook the Meatballs
Form meatballs about 1 to 1.5 inches in diameter. Either bake at 400°F for 15–18 minutes or pan-fry until browned and cooked through.
Step 3: Glaze the Meatballs
In a small saucepan, warm your Korean BBQ sauce. Toss the cooked meatballs in the sauce until fully coated and sticky.
Step 4: Quick Pickle the Veggies
Julienne carrots and daikon (or substitute with just carrots). Toss them in rice vinegar, a pinch of sugar, and salt. Let sit for 15–30 minutes.
Step 5: Toast the Baguette
Slice the baguette and toast it in the oven or toaster oven until golden and crisp.
Step 6: Assemble the Banh Mi
Spread mayonnaise on both sides of the baguette. Add a generous layer of pickled veggies, then the BBQ-glazed meatballs. Top with jalapeño slices, fresh cilantro, and extra sauce if desired.

Serving and Storing This Korean BBQ Meatball Banh Mi
Serve your Banh Mi warm, with the baguette freshly toasted for that perfect crunch. Pair it with a side of sesame slaw or crispy fries for a hearty meal. For drinks, Thai iced tea or a citrusy soda balances the spice beautifully.
Storing leftovers? Store components separately. Meatballs can be refrigerated up to 3 days or frozen for 2 months. Pickled veggies keep well in the fridge for up to a week. Assemble just before serving for the best texture.
Frequently Asked Questions
Can I use a different protein for the meatballs?
Absolutely! Ground chicken or turkey also work well, though they tend to be leaner. You may want to add a splash of oil or extra egg for moisture.
Is Korean BBQ sauce the same as gochujang?
Not quite. Gochujang is a spicy fermented chili paste, often used as a base for Korean BBQ sauce but not the same. Use a store-bought Korean BBQ sauce or make your own with gochujang, soy sauce, sugar, garlic, and sesame oil.
Can I make this gluten-free?
Yes. Use gluten-free breadcrumbs and a gluten-free baguette. Double-check your soy sauce label or use tamari.
What if I don’t like cilantro?
No problem! Try fresh basil, mint, or even green onions. The fresh herbs give the sandwich brightness, so include something green.
Can I prep everything ahead?
Yes! Meatballs and pickled veggies can be prepped 1-2 days in advance. Just reheat and assemble before serving.
Are there vegetarian options?
You could substitute the meatballs with plant-based meat or marinated tofu cubes and still follow the same glazing method.
Want More Sandwich Ideas with a Twist?
If you love this Korean BBQ Meatball Banh Mi, you’ll definitely want to check out these other flavor-packed sandwiches:
- Cheesy Garlic Chicken Wraps with a creamy, melty center.
- Chicken Street Tacos for a handheld flavor fiesta.
- Tzatziki Chicken Veggie Naan Pizza for Mediterranean flair in every bite.
- Bang Bang Chicken Recipe with crispy bites and spicy-sweet sauce.
- Golden Crispy Chicken with Parmesan Mushroom Sauce when you want comfort food upgraded.
Save This Pin For Later
📌 Save this recipe to your Pinterest sandwich board so you can come back to it any time: Kitchen By Kate on Pinterest.
And let me know in the comments how yours turned out! Did you go heavy on the jalapeños or swap in sriracha mayo? I love seeing your spins on this delicious sandwich. Questions are welcome too—let’s help each other cook smarter.


Korean BBQ Meatball Banh Mi
- Total Time: 40 minutes
- Yield: 4 servings
Description
This Korean BBQ Meatball Banh Mi recipe brings together tender Korean-style meatballs glazed in spicy-sweet BBQ sauce, crunchy pickled vegetables, and fresh herbs all packed into a crispy baguette. A flavor-packed sandwich perfect for lunch or dinner. Keywords: Korean BBQ sandwich, Banh Mi meatball, fusion recipes, easy weeknight sandwich, Asian sandwich ideas.
Ingredients
1 lb ground pork or ground beef
2 cloves garlic, minced
1 tbsp fresh ginger, grated
2 tbsp soy sauce
1 tsp sesame oil
1/3 cup panko breadcrumbs
1 egg
1/2 cup Korean BBQ sauce (gochujang-based or store-bought)
1/2 cup carrots, julienned
1/2 cup daikon radish, julienned
1/4 cup rice vinegar
1/2 tsp sugar
1/4 tsp salt
1 large baguette
1/4 cup mayonnaise
1/4 cup fresh cilantro leaves
1 jalapeño, thinly sliced (optional)
Instructions
1. In a large mixing bowl, combine ground pork, garlic, ginger, soy sauce, sesame oil, breadcrumbs, and egg. Mix just until combined.
2. Shape mixture into 1 to 1.5 inch meatballs. Bake at 400°F for 15–18 minutes or pan-fry until browned and cooked through.
3. Warm the Korean BBQ sauce in a small saucepan. Toss the cooked meatballs in the sauce until fully coated.
4. In a separate bowl, combine carrots and daikon with rice vinegar, sugar, and salt. Let sit for 15–30 minutes to quick-pickle.
5. Slice and lightly toast the baguette in the oven until golden and crisp.
6. Spread mayonnaise on both sides of the toasted baguette. Layer in pickled vegetables, glazed meatballs, cilantro, and jalapeños if using.
7. Serve immediately while the bread is warm and crispy.
Notes
Don’t overmix the meatball mixture to keep them tender and juicy.
Always pickle your vegetables at least 15 minutes ahead to let the flavors develop.
Toasting the baguette just before assembling ensures maximum crunch.
- Prep Time: 20 minutes
- Cook Time: 20 minutes
- Category: Sandwich
- Method: Baked or Pan-Fried
- Cuisine: Fusion, Korean-Vietnamese
Nutrition
- Serving Size: 1 sandwich
- Calories: 530
- Sugar: 7g
- Sodium: 850mg
- Fat: 28g
- Saturated Fat: 7g
- Unsaturated Fat: 18g
- Trans Fat: 0g
- Carbohydrates: 42g
- Fiber: 3g
- Protein: 26g
- Cholesterol: 95mg
